I have read quite a bit on how habits work and how our brains function and it seems that once you create a habit- it is impossible to get rid of it! Let me give you an example:

- You are addicted to PE-ing. You are used to visiting [words=http://www.mattersofsize.com/join-now.html]MOS[/words] every single day to see how things are going and do PE for about an hour (manually active, not actively healing). You've done this for about 2 years. It has grown into a habit you can not get rid of- you do it subconciously, you don't want to come and check [words=http://www.mattersofsize.com/join-now.html]MOS[/words], but it just feels somewhat "wrong" not doing it. And it does not stop UNTIL you replace your old habits with new ones. A habit can not be removed- it can only be replaced. So if you are thinking on quitting [words=http://www.mattersofsize.com/join-now.html]MOS[/words]/ PE-ing- I advise you to create another habitual routine in the exact same time you used to do your PE sessions. That way your old habits would be replaced and you will be developing in a new area of your life. Whether it be fitness, health, business etc. I read most of the info I wrote above in a book called "The Power Of Habit" recommended to me by a brother here on [words=http://www.mattersofsize.com/join-now.html]MOS[/words].
